VeinViewer® Flex
VeinViewer® Flex brings near-infrared (NIR) imaging to project a real-time map of the patient’s vasculature directly onto the skin. Its lightweight design supports clinicians who need vein visualization across labs, outpatient clinics, bedside care, blood draw areas, and other clinical environments where mobility and ease of use are important.

Choosing a vein is only part of the decision. Choosing the appropriate catheter size for that vein matters, too.
CathCompass™ uses near-infrared technology with a color-coded catheter sizing guide. Clinicians can compare the selected vein to standard catheter gauges to make more informed decisions about the catheter-to-vein ratio.
CathCompass™ helps clinicians:
Evaluate the vessel before choosing a catheter
Better align catheter selection with vein size
Support PIVC decisions in difficult-access patients
Build confidence in catheter-to-vein ratio evaluation
Add a visual check to peripheral IV planning
When the correct catheter size is chosen, the average first-stick success increases.
Benefits Across the Access Process
Pre-Access
Reveal more potential access sites, support vein selection with real-time visualization, and help assess difficult venous access.
During Access
Support an eyes-on-patient technique, add catheter sizing guidance with CathCompass™, and help clinicians stay focused on placement.
Post-Access
Assess IV patency through fluid flushing visualization, detect hematoma formation as it develops, and support documentation with image capture.
